/**
* Define new types of items that can be searched.
*
* This hook allows modules to define their own item types, for which indexes
* can then be created. (Note that the Search API natively provides support for
* all entity types that specify property information, so they should not be
* added here. You should therefore also not use an existing entity type as the
* identifier of a new item type.)
*
* The main part of defining a new item type is implementing its data source
* controller class, which is responsible for loading items, providing metadata
* and tracking existing items. The module defining a certain item type is also
* responsible for observing creations, updates and deletions of items of that
* type and notifying the Search API of them by calling
* search_api_track_item_insert(), search_api_track_item_change() and
* search_api_track_item_delete(), as appropriate.
* The only other restriction for item types is that they have to have a single
* item ID field, with a scalar value. This is, e.g., used to track indexed
* items.
*
* Note, however, that you can also define item types where some of these
* conditions are not met, as long as you are aware that some functionality of
* the Search API and related modules might then not be available for that type.
*
* @return array
* An associative array keyed by item type identifier, and containing type
* information arrays with at least the following keys:
* - name: A human-readable name for the type.
* - datasource controller: A class implementing the
* SearchApiDataSourceControllerInterface interface which will be used as
* the data source controller for this type.
* Other, datasource-specific settings might also be placed here. These should
* be specified with the data source controller in question.
*
* @see hook_search_api_item_type_info_alter()
*/
function hook_search_api_item_type_info() {
// Copied from search_api_search_api_item_type_info().
$types = array();
foreach (entity_get_property_info() as $type => $property_info) {
if ($info = entity_get_info($type)) {
$types[$type] = array(
'name' => $info['label'],
'datasource controller' => 'SearchApiEntityDataSourceController',
);
}
}
return $types;
}
/**
* Alter the item type info.
*
* Modules may implement this hook to alter the information that defines an
* item type. All properties that are available in
* hook_search_api_item_type_info() can be altered here.
*
* @param array $infos
* The item type info array, keyed by type identifier.
*
* @see hook_search_api_item_type_info()
*/
function hook_search_api_item_type_info_alter(array &$infos) {
// Adds a boolean value is_entity to all type options telling whether the item
// type represents an entity type.
foreach ($infos as $type => $info) {
$info['is_entity'] = (bool) entity_get_info($type);
}
}

/**
* Define new data types for indexed properties.
*
* New data types will appear as new option for the „Type“ field on indexes'
* „Fields“ tabs. Whether choosing a custom data type will have any effect
* depends on the server on which the data is indexed.
*
* @return array
* An array containing custom data type definitions, keyed by their type
* identifier and containing the following keys:
* - name: The human-readable name of the type.
* - fallback: (optional) One of the default data types (the keys from
* search_api_default_field_types()) which should be used as a fallback if
* the server doesn't support this data type. Defaults to "string".
* - conversion callback: (optional) If specified, a callback function for
* converting raw values to the given type, if possible. For the contract
* of such a callback, see example_data_type_conversion().
*
* @see hook_search_api_data_type_info_alter()
* @see search_api_get_data_type_info()
* @see example_data_type_conversion()
*/
function hook_search_api_data_type_info() {
return array(
'example_type' => array(
'name' => t('Example type'),
// Could be omitted, as "string" is the default.
'fallback' => 'string',
'conversion callback' => 'example_data_type_conversion',
),
);
}
/**
* Alter the data type info.
*
* Modules may implement this hook to alter the information that defines a data
* type, or to add/remove some entirely. All properties that are available in
* hook_search_api_data_type_info() can be altered here.
*
* @param array $infos
* The data type info array, keyed by type identifier.
*
* @see hook_search_api_data_type_info()
*/
function hook_search_api_data_type_info_alter(array &$infos) {
$infos['example_type']['name'] .= ' 2';
}

/**
* Registers one or more processors. These are classes implementing the
* SearchApiProcessorInterface interface which can be used at index and search
* time to pre-process item data or the search query, and at search time to
* post-process the returned search results.
*
* @see SearchApiProcessorInterface
*
* @return array
* An associative array keyed by the processor id and containing arrays
* with the following keys:
* - name: The name to display for this processor.
* - description: A short description of what the processor does at each
* phase.
* - class: The processor class, which has to implement the
* SearchApiProcessorInterface interface.
* - weight: (optional) Defines the order in which processors are displayed
* (and, therefore, invoked) by default. Defaults to 0.
*/
function hook_search_api_processor_info() {
$callbacks['example_processor'] = array(
'name' => t('Example processor'),
'description' => t('Pre- and post-processes data in really cool ways.'),
'class' => 'ExampleSearchApiProcessor',
'weight' => -1,
);
$callbacks['example_processor_minimal'] = array(
'name' => t('Example processor 2'),
'description' => t('Processor with minimal description.'),
'class' => 'ExampleSearchApiProcessor2',
);
return $callbacks;
}
/**
* Allows you to log or alter the items that are indexed.
*
* Please be aware that generally preventing the indexing of certain items is
* deprecated. This is better done with data alterations, which can easily be
* configured and only added to indexes where this behaviour is wanted.
* If your module will use this hook to reject certain items from indexing,
* please document this clearly to avoid confusion.
*
* @param array $items
* The entities that will be indexed (before calling any data alterations).
* @param SearchApiIndex $index
* The search index on which items will be indexed.
*/
function hook_search_api_index_items_alter(array &$items, SearchApiIndex $index) {
foreach ($items as $id => $item) {
if ($id % 5 == 0) {
unset($items[$id]);
}
}

/**
* Convert a raw value from an entity to a custom data type.
*
* This function will be called for fields of the specific data type to convert
* all individual values of the field to the correct format.
*
* @param $value
* The raw, single value, as extracted from an entity wrapper.
* @param $original_type
* The original Entity API type of the value.
* @param $type
* The custom data type to which the value should be converted. Can be ignored
* if the callback is only used for a single data type.
*
* @return
* The converted value, if a conversion could be executed. NULL otherwise.
*
* @see hook_search_api_data_type_info()
*/
function example_data_type_conversion($value, $original_type, $type) {
if ($type === 'example_type') {
// The example_type type apparently requires a rather complex data format.
return array(
'value' => $value,
'original' => $original_type,
);
}
// Someone used this callback for another, unknown type. Return NULL.
// (Normally, you can just assume that the/a correct type is given.)
return NULL;
}
